One of My Favorite Scallop Recipes
July 23rd, 2008 Posted in UncategorizedToday, I am sharing with you one of my favorite easy recipes, Scallops in Cream Sauce. This is a fabulous recipe that can be made in advance and then heated in the oven at the last minute. Enjoy!
Preheat oven to 450°
SCALLOPS
Wash 1 1/2 lbs scallops. If they are large sea scallops, cut them into quarters. Put in saucepan with: 2 tablespoon chopped shallots, 1/2 teaspoon salt, a few dashes of white pepper, and 1 cup dry vermouth. Bring liquid to a boil, cover saucepan, and simmer over low heat for 2 minutes only. Remove scallops with a slotted spoon, and divide into 4 scallops shells or put in a heat resistant pan. Cook liquid remaining in saucepan over high heat until reduced to half.
SAUCE
Add to reduced liquid: 1 cup cream. Stir and boil rapidly until cream is reduced and sauce is the consistency of syrup.
Combine: 1 tablespoon of flour and 4 tablespoons soft butter. Reduce heat and gradually stir in butter bit by bit.
PRESENTATION
Pour the sauce over the scallops, sprinkle with minced parsley, and heat in the very hot oven for 5 minutes or until the top has browned a bit.
This wonderfully easy meal can be served in scallop shells or over rice.
